What is New York 10-13 Association Incorporated?
New York 10-13 Association Incorporated is a nonprofit organization primarily serving retired members of the New York City Police Department. Their primary function is to keep members informed about changes in health and retirement benefits, as well as other significant alterations impacting active and retired police officers. The organization's purpose is to maintain connections with retired law enforcement personnel and offer assistance when needed, in whatever form is required. Funding for these activities is sourced through membership dues and donations.

Is New York 10-13 Association Incorporated legitimate?
New York 10-13 Association Incorporated is a legitimate nonprofit organization registered as a 501(c)(5) entity. New York 10-13 Association Incorporated submitted a form 990, which is a tax form used by tax-exempt organizations in the U.S., indicating its operational transparency and adherence to regulatory requirements. Donations to this organization are tax deductible.
